UK Healthcare Data Storage Market Overview
As per MRFR analysis, the UK Healthcare Data Storage Market Size was estimated at 1.66 (USD Billion) in 2024.The UK Healthcare Data Storage Market Industry is expected to grow from 1.92(USD Billion) in 2025 2.73 (USD Billion) by 2035. The UK Healthcare Data Storage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 3.267%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035)

UK Healthcare Data Storage Market Drivers
Increasing Digital Health Initiatives
The UK is witnessing a significant push towards digital health initiatives, particularly with the National Health Service (NHS) aiming to transition to a fully digital operation by 2024. This shift is largely driven by the need for improved patient outcomes and streamlined healthcare services.
According to NHS Digital, over 50% of consultations have moved online since the pandemic, resulting in increased demand for secure data storage solutions within the UK Healthcare Data Storage Market Industry.As healthcare providers collect more patient data digitally, the necessity for robust data storage systems becomes imperative to ensure data integrity and patient confidentiality.
Rising Data Compliance Requirements
With the introduction of stringent regulations such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), the UK healthcare sector is under immense pressure to ensure compliance regarding patient data management. The Information Commissioner's Office has reported a 30% increase in financial penalties associated with data breaches since GDPR implementation.
This growing concern emphasizes the need for secure data storage solutions compliant with these regulations, positively impacting the UK Healthcare Data Storage Market Industry.Healthcare organizations are now investing substantially in advanced storage technologies to mitigate risks and enhance their compliance frameworks.
Expansion of Cloud-based Healthcare Solutions
The healthcare sector in the UK is increasingly adopting cloud-based storage solutions, driven by the need for flexibility and scalability in data management. A report from the UK Cloud Alliance indicates that 40% of healthcare organizations are expected to transition their services to the cloud by 2025. This transition allows for seamless access to data across multiple locations and devices, which is vital for a cohesive healthcare delivery system.
Companies like Microsoft and Amazon Web Services are already working with the NHS to simplify the implementation of the cloud, thus driving the further development of the UK Healthcare Data Storage Market Industry.

Healthcare Data Storage Market Type Insights
The UK Healthcare Data Storage Market is increasingly evolving, driven by the growing need for efficient data management and security in healthcare facilities. Within the Type segment, Flash and Solid-State Storage solutions have gained prominence due to their high speed and reliability in data retrieval, essential for real-time patient care and electronic health records management. Such technologies are particularly beneficial for hospitals and clinics looking to enhance their operational efficiency and meet regulatory compliance requirements. On the other hand, Magnetic Storage continues to play a significant role, primarily in archiving large volumes of data at lower costs, making it a favored choice for long-term data retention strategies.

Healthcare Data Storage Market Storage System Insights
The Storage System segment within the UK Healthcare Data Storage Market plays a crucial role in managing and preserving sensitive patient data, which is becoming increasingly important with the rise of digital health records. Storage Area Networks (SANs) are especially significant as they provide high-speed access to data, enabling healthcare providers to efficiently retrieve patient information and enhance the quality of care. Meanwhile, Direct-Attached Storage (DAS) serves as a practical solution for smaller practices that require straightforward and cost-effective data storage solutions.Both types of storage systems support compliance with stringent data protection regulations in the UK,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R).

UK Healthcare Data Storage Market Industry Developments
The UK Healthcare Data Storage Market has witnessed considerable advancements, particularly with increased investments in data security and compliance with GDPR regulations. Notable players such as Cisco Systems, Oracle, and Microsoft have enhanced their offerings to provide secure cloud storage solutions tailored for healthcare providers, which has become increasingly critical amidst the rise of digital patient records. In recent months, Oracle announced its acquisition of Cerner in June 2022, which bolstered its position in the healthcare data management space, while Cisco Systems has continuously expanded its cybersecurity capabilities to safeguard healthcare data.
The growing demand for big data analytics has driven companies like Cloudera and Teradata to develop specialized solutions aimed at improving patient outcomes and operational efficiency. Additionally, companies such as Amazon Web Services and Google are focusing on providing advanced cloud infrastructure for healthcare providers, contributing to market growth.
